Excel facilita la creación del divertido software aritmético para niños

  
. El interés es la fuerza motriz del aprendizaje. Siempre es más divertido probar la capacidad aritmética de su hijo en forma de software dinámico y puntajes de juicio automático. ¡Si no está satisfecho con el software aritmético para niños en línea, edite automáticamente una versión Excel del software de prueba aritmética! Dicho software de prueba se puede compilar con Excel usando un simple código VBA. Xiaobian recomendó "Descargar WPS Office" 1. La interfaz de decoración de personajes de dibujos animados presenta la interfaz de operación principal del software de creación de hojas de trabajo. Puede usar los personajes animados que a los niños les gusta ver y decorar la interfaz, como Pleasant Goat, Big Big Wolf, etc.
(Figura 1). Figura 1 [Nota 1 Nota: 1.C6 celda como la celda de visualización para establecer el alcance del problema 2.B8, B10, B12 son el área de visualización del número de prueba (caja negra), B9 es el área del símbolo aritmético, B11 es el signo igual Las áreas de visualización para información de retroalimentación son el área 3.C8, C10, C12, C17, E17, G17 4. El panel de selección cambia el nombre de las imágenes, gráficos y otros elementos insertados. 2. Uso de la verificación de datos para realizar una verificación de datos de múltiples energías Para establecer la elección de los símbolos aritméticos, con el fin de lograr una variedad de funciones del programa, como la suma y la resta (Figura 2). Figura 23. Visualización de información El proceso es principalmente una función simple para configurar la información de visualización para la celda (Figura 3). Figura 3 [Nota 3 Nota: 1. Ingrese la fórmula en la celda C8 como " = REPT (" ★ |  ", $ B $ 8) ", lo que significa que se muestra n ($ B $ 8 valor de celda) en la celda C8. Del mismo modo, en la celda C10, ingrese " = REPT (" ★ |  ", $ B $ 10) " 2. Defina un nombre AAA " para convertir una cadena que consiste en B8, B9 y B10 en una fórmula para el cálculo. En la celda C12, escriba " = IF ($ B $ 12 = AAA, " √ " &REPT (" ★ |  ", $ B $ 12), IF ($ B $ 12 = " ", "? Bebé, comienza con la aritmética? ¡Buena suerte! ", Х Baby, te equivocas, cuéntalo de nuevo. ? ")) ", que indica que se muestra información diferente en C12 de acuerdo con el resultado de la respuesta] 4. Las indicaciones verdaderas o falsas usan colores en el caso de que el bebé aún tenga pocas palabras, es una buena idea usar la sugerencia de color correcta o incorrecta para el bebé. Este proceso está configurado para mostrar diferentes colores de acuerdo con la respuesta del bebé a la pregunta (Figura 4). Figura 4 [Figura 4 Nota: 1. Seleccione la celda B12: C12, use el formato condicional "Nueva Regla" para crear dos reglas de visualización de celda 2. La fórmula de la Regla 1 es "L" (LEC ($ C $ 12, 1) = "? &Quot; ", el formato es blanco sobre un fondo azul, usado para mostrar cuando B12 está vacío. 3. La fórmula de la regla 2 es " = LEFT ($ C $ 12,1) = " X " ", el formato es una palabra amarillo rojo-amarillo, que se utiliza para mostrar las dos celdas cuando el resultado del cálculo es incorrecto. 5. Realice la interacción del código VBA con la recompensa y las indicaciones de voz. Creo que al bebé le debe gustar. Este proceso consiste en utilizar el código VBA para resolver el problema, juzgar automáticamente los resultados de la respuesta y, de acuerdo con los resultados de la respuesta, hacer diferentes indicaciones de voz y recompensas de imagen. Haga clic en el botón Visual Basic en la pestaña "Herramientas de desarrollo", haga doble clic en Sheet1 en la ventana izquierda e ingrese el código en la imagen en la ventana derecha (puede pegar el código en http://pan.baidu.com/s/1kTyXI7t) En la ventana) (Figura 5). Figura 5 [Figura 5 Nota: 1. "Inicialización" La función principal de este proceso macro es borrar la fórmula, información de solicitud 2. "Problema" "La función principal de este proceso macro se basa en el alcance y el cálculo establecidos El símbolo genera sumas, restas y restas, y utiliza Application.Speech.Speak para indicaciones de voz. Por supuesto, también puede eliminar la declaración de solicitud de voz o cambiar el contenido de la solicitud de voz. 3.Enviar; enviar " La función principal de este proceso macro es juzgar el resultado de la respuesta del bebé y hacer las indicaciones de voz correspondientes y actualizar la información de la solicitud. Puede cambiar el código en el código a "nombre de archivo de imagen de bebé que le gusta a bebé, pero el archivo de imagen debe estar en la misma carpeta que este archivo de Excel". 6. Cuanto más simple sea el botón de operación, más fácil será para el bebé comenzar. . Este proceso consiste en utilizar el control de "botón" en el control de formulario para lograr una operación simple, de modo que el bebé pueda aprender felizmente con solo 3 botones (Figura 6). Figura 6 [Figura 6 Nota: 1. Haga clic en la pestaña "Herramientas de desarrollo" en el menú "Insertar" debajo del botón "Botón (Control de formulario)", dibuje un botón en la posición correspondiente en la interfaz y Apunta a la macro correspondiente. 2. Haga clic con el botón derecho en el botón correspondiente para seleccionar el menú "Editar texto" para modificar la etiqueta del botón al contenido deseado. 7. Proteja la hoja de trabajo para evitar que el bebé confunda otras células, lo que afecta el aprendizaje. Use la hoja de trabajo de protección para realizar la configuración apropiada (Figura 7). Figura 7 [Nota 7 Nota: 1. Use la tecla Ctrl para seleccionar las celdas activas en la interfaz y elimine sus bloqueos de protección. 2. Verifique las líneas de la cuadrícula y el título en la pestaña " Diseño de página ". Elimine 3.proteger la hoja de trabajo y marque "" Seleccionar celdas desbloqueadas" y "Editar objetos". Una vez completados los pasos anteriores, haga clic en cada botón en la interfaz de operación para verificar si el bebé tiene razón. ¿Interesado en la forma de aprender (Figura 8)? Figura 8 Este artículo es de [Inicio del sistema] www.xp85.com
Copyright © Conocimiento de Windows All Rights Reserved